Abstract

DOUBLE LUG RECLOSABLE FOOD PACKAGES Abstract of the Disclosure This invention pertains to a reclosable package having a body member, a base member having a pedestal, a hermetic seal between the body member and the base member and snap locking structures in the respective sidewalls of the body member and base member. Opposing pairs of snap locking indents/detents are provided on a sidewall of the base pedestal and on an opposing sidewall of a moat-like portion of a tongue-and-groove structure provided in peripheral portions of the body member and base member.

Claims (6)

1. A food package comprising:
(a) a base member having an upstanding pedestal including a pedestal panel portion and a pedestal sidewall, said base member including a slot portion peripheral of and substantially adjacent to at least a portion of said pedestal sidewall, said base member further including a generally upstanding ring portion substantially adjacent to said slot portion of said base member, whereby said slot portion is generally between said pedestal sidewall and said ring portion;
(b) a body member having an upstanding bubble including a bubble panel portion and a bubble sidewall, said body member including a generally upstanding ring portion and a slot portion so as to provide the body member with structures complementary in shape and size and matingly engageable with said respective slot portion and generally upstanding ring portion of the base member, whereby a general tongue-and-groove assembly structure is provided by said ring portion and slot portion of said base member and body member are in generally telescoping engagement with each other;
(c) sealing means for attaching said base member to said body member with a peelable seal that is hermetic, suitable for vacuum packaging and openable with digital pull-apart forces, said sealing means being within said tongue-and-groove assembly; and (d) means for reclosing the food package by engaging a portion of said base member with a portion of said body member, said reclosing means including opposing pairs of interfering projections, one said pair of interfering projections being in said pedestal sidewall and said bubble sidewall, and an opposing said pair of interfering projections being in base member and body member sidewalls within the tongue-and-groove assembly structure.
2. The food package according to claim 1, wherein said opposing pairs of interfering projections are substantially directly opposite to each other at a height within a moat area of the tongue-and-groove assembly structure.
3. The food package according to claim 1, wherein said interfering projections of the body member are under compression and wherein said interfering projections of the base member are under tension when the base member and body member are assembled together.
4. The food package according to claim 1, wherein said interfering projection pairs are a complementarily shaped indent and a raised detent.
5. The food package according to claim 1, wherein said generally upstanding ring portion of the base member has an upstanding edge which is generally rounded.
6. The food package according to claim 1, wherein said pedestal sidewall is tapered in a direction from said slot portion of the base member to said pedestal panel portion.
